What: Free Entrance Days
Where: 100 Select US National Parks
When: November 11, 2010 (Veterans Day)
Cost: Fee waiver includes: entrance fees, commercial tour fees, and transportation entrance fees. Other fees such as reservations, camping, tours, concession and fees collected by third parties are not included unless stated otherwise.
This deal is good at numerous National Parks including several within Georgia such as: Chattahoochee River National Recreation Area and the Chickamauga and Chattahoochee National Military Park. If you’re headed south, you can also visit Cumberland Island National Seashore, Fort Frederica National Monument or Fort Pulaski National Monument as part of the fee free weekend.
